Avantages du protocole HTTP/2 pour la rapidité d’un site web

Découvrez comment le HTTP/2 révolutionne la vitesse et l’expérience utilisateur sur le web. Au revoir les chargements laborieux, bonjour aux performances dynamiques et à une navigation fluide comme l’air !

Introduction au protocole HTTP/2

Le monde du web ne cesse d’évoluer et avec lui, les protocoles qui en sont la colonne vertébrale. L’introduction du HTTP/2 marque une avancée significative par rapport à son prédécesseur, le HTTP/1. 1. Conçu pour optimiser la rapidité de navigation, HTTP/2 introduit des innovations telles que le multiplexage, permettant l’envoi de plusieurs requêtes en simultané sur une seule connexion TCP. C’est un pas de géant vers l’accélération des temps de chargement. Avec la compression des en-têtes grâce au mécanisme HPACK, HTTP/2 réduit considérablement le volume de données échangées entre clients et serveurs. Cette astuce technique allège la charge sur les réseaux et diminue encore plus efficacement les délais d’attente pour l’utilisateur final. Une expérience utilisateur fluide est alors moins une aspiration qu’une réalité tangible. La sécurité n’est pas mise de côté; bien au contraire! HTTP/2 s’appuie généralement sur TLS (Transport Layer Security), renforçant ainsi la confidentialité et l’intégrité des données transmises.

Multiplexage et performance web

L’ère du numérique impose une navigation web rapide comme l’éclair; d’où l’intérêt grandissant pour le protocole HTTP/2. Cette technologie de pointe optimise les performances en permettant le multiplexage, soit la capacité à envoyer plusieurs requêtes en parallèle au sein d’une même connexion TCP. Finis les embouteillages de données, chaque élément d’une page charge sans attendre son tour, éliminant pratiquement les retards dus à la mise en file. Avec HTTP/2, on dit adieu aux anciennes limites et bonjour à un débit amélioré. La compression des en-têtes grâce au système HPACK réduit sensiblement la quantité de données échangées entre serveur et client. Les pages web deviennent ainsi plus légères, ce qui se traduit par des temps de chargement diminués et une satisfaction visiteur nettement renforcée. Prioriser le chargement des ressources qui comptent vraiment amène un vent de fraîcheur sur l’expérience utilisateur. Lorsqu’un navigateur demande une page, HTTP/2 distingue instantanément les composantes essentielles pour accélérer leur livraison.

Compression des en-têtes HPACK

Dans le monde dynamique du web, la rapidité d’affichage des pages est cruciale. Le protocole HTTP/2 apporte une innovation majeure avec la compression HPACK qui réduit considérablement la taille des en-têtes HTTP. Cette technique élimine la redondance et limite les allers-retours entre le client et le serveur, permettant ainsi aux pages de charger plus vite que jamais. Imaginez un livre où chaque chapitre commence par répéter l’index ; c’est à peu près comment fonctionnait HTTP/1. Avec HTTP/2, c’est comme si on ne gardait que l’essentiel à chaque nouvelle page consultée ! Cela optimise significativement les ressources réseau et améliore l’expérience utilisateur grâce à des temps de réponse réduits.

Priorisation des ressources avec HTTP/2

Optimisation intelligente du chargement

Avec HTTP/2, on assiste à une révolution dans la gestion des ressources web. Ce protocole sait reconnaître les éléments prioritaires d’une page, permettant ainsi de charger en premier ce qui compte vraiment pour l’utilisateur. Fini le temps où toutes les données arrivaient au même moment sans ordre précis !

Hiérarchie efficace

En coulisse, HTTP/2 travaille dur pour établir une hiérarchie fine et dynamique. Les fichiers CSS et JavaScript critiques? Ils prennent la pole position. Images et contenus secondaires suivent en douceur, sans bousculer l’expérience utilisateur par des chargements intempestifs.

Interaction fluide avec le site

Cette priorisation méticuleuse se traduit par une fluidité remarquable lors de la navigation. L’internaute perçoit un site réactif ; il reste engagé car le contenu essentiel lui est servi sans délai, renforçant ainsi son confort de visite et sa satisfaction générale.

Répercussions positives sur mobile

Sur mobile, où chaque milliseconde compte doublement, HTTP/2 fait des merveilles. En ajustant la livraison des ressources selon leur importance, les pages se montrent vives et légères même avec une connexion capricieuse – un atout majeur dans notre monde constamment en mouvement.

Streaming de serveur : avantages pour la vitesse

Le dynamisme du streaming serveur

Imaginez un flux continu et rapide, tel une rivière dévalant la montagne. C’est ce que permet le streaming de serveur avec HTTP/2. En envoyant les données au fur et à mesure de leur disponibilité, l’utilisateur reçoit l’information sans attendre que tout soit prêt. Une vraie course contre la montre gagnée !

L’impact sur la vitesse de chargement

Chaque seconde compte lorsqu’il s’agit du chargement d’une page web. Grâce à cette technique, on observe une nette amélioration : les éléments vitaux arrivent en premier, éveillant ainsi l’intérêt sans perdre de temps.

Une synergie avec le multiplexage

Le streaming ne danse pas seul ; il est en parfaite harmonie avec le multiplexage. Cette combinaison offre une expérience fluide où des requêtes multiples coexistent sans friction, comme plusieurs voix dans une chorale bien coordonnée.

Réduction de latence et expérience utilisateur

Dans l’univers numérique actuel, un site web rapide équivaut à une autoroute sans embouteillage pour les internautes. Grâce au protocole HTTP/2, la latence s’amenuise significativement, propulsant ainsi le confort de navigation à un niveau supérieur. Imaginez que chaque clic déclenche une réponse quasi instantanée ; c’est ce que permet HTTP/2 en optimisant l’échange de données entre serveur et client. L’expérience devient fluide, presque intuitive, donnant l’impression d’une conversation continue sans ces irritants temps morts. Il est reconnu qu’un utilisateur satisfait est synonyme d’une visite prolongée et d’un engagement accru. En minimisant les délais grâce au multiplexage et à la compression des en-têtes avec HPACK, HTTP/2 transforme la patience en un concept désuet sur le web. La rapidité accrue forge une expérience agréable où attendre n’est plus nécessaire; tout se passe dans l’instantanéité, comme par magie.

Sécurité renforcée avec HTTP/2

Dans l’ère numérique où la sécurité est un enjeu majeur, HTTP/2 apporte une couche supplémentaire de protection. Ce protocole moderne exige l’utilisation du chiffrement via TLS (Transport Layer Security), réduisant ainsi les risques d’attaques de type « man-in-the-middle ». En effet, ces mesures obligent à une confidentialité accrue des données transmises entre le navigateur et le serveur. Avec HTTP/2, la notion de sûreté va de pair avec performance. Les connexions sont non seulement sécurisées mais optimisées, permettant aux utilisateurs de profiter d’une navigation sereine et fluide. Cette combinaison gagnante favorise une expérience utilisateur sans faille, renforçant du même coup leur confiance envers les sites web qui adoptent cette technologie. Quant au référencement naturel, il bénéficie indirectement de ce climat de confiance instauré par HTTP/2. Google valorise les sites qui prennent au sérieux la protection des internautes.

Cas d’utilisation du multiplexage en pratique

Dans le monde numérique d’aujourd’hui, chaque seconde compte. Le HTTP/2 change la donne avec son système de multiplexage. Cette technique permet à plusieurs requêtes de s’échanger simultanément sur une unique connexion TCP, évitant ainsi l’encombrement et les retards dus au chargement séquentiel des ressources. C’est comme passer d’une route à voie unique à une autoroute à multiples voies : le trafic web s’accélère significativement. Prenons un exemple concret : un site e-commerce lors d’une grande vente flash. Avant, avec HTTP/1. X, les images, CSS et JavaScript pouvaient créer des bouchons digitaux frustrants pour l’acheteur pressé. Avec le multiplexage de HTTP/2, ces éléments chargent en parallèle, fluidifiant l’expérience utilisateur et stimulant potentiellement les conversions. Imaginez-vous en train de consulter votre fil d’actualités sur un réseau social. Grâce au multiplexage du HTTP/2, le contenu riche, vidéos, GIFs et images, se charge rapidement et sans accroc même lorsque vous défilez rapidement la page. L’utilisateur reste captivé; il n’y a plus de temps mort où l’impatience pourrait gagner du terrain.

Impact de HTTP/2 sur le référencement naturel

L’adoption du protocole HTTP/2 marque un tournant dans la manière dont les sites web communiquent avec les navigateurs, portant ainsi un coup de fouet à leur vélocité. Grâce au multiplexage, qui permet l’envoi simultané de plusieurs requêtes sur une même connexion, les engorgements typiques d’HTTP/1. X s’évaporent comme neige au soleil. Cette fluidité se traduit par des pages qui chargent plus vite, offrant aux internautes une satisfaction immédiate et décourageant moins le clic impatient. Dans le monde impitoyable du référencement naturel où chaque milliseconde compte, la vitesse de chargement est reine. L’avantage avec HTTP/2 ? Il booste cette métrique essentielle que Google intègre dans son algorithme pour classer les sites web. En conséquence, ceux embrassant HTTP/2 peuvent observer une amélioration notable dans leur positionnement organique, c’est un peu comme donner des ailes à votre contenu pour qu’il atteigne les sommets des résultats de recherche. Ne pas négliger l’aspect sécurité : HTTP/2 va souvent de pair avec HTTPS grâce auquel transitent des données chiffrées. Ce n’est pas juste une question de protéger les échanges mais aussi d’inspirer confiance auprès des moteurs comme Google qui favorisent ces pratiques sécuritaires dans leur indexation.

Transition vers HTTP/2 : étapes clés et bonnes pratiques

Bien commencer avec HTTP/2

Pour booster la rapidité de votre site, l’adoption du protocole HTTP/2 est un véritable coup d’accélérateur. Avant de plonger les mains dans le cambouis, assurez-vous que votre hébergeur supporte ce protocole. C’est une étape non négociable pour bénéficier des bienfaits de cette technologie.

Un certificat SSL : indispensable

La sécurité n’est pas à prendre à la légère. Avec HTTP/2, l’utilisation d’un certificat SSL devient incontournable. Non seulement il sécurise les échanges sur votre site, mais c’est aussi un prérequis technique pour HTTP/2 qui ne fonctionne qu’en mode chiffré.

Mise à jour des serveurs et outils

Vérifiez que vos serveurs sont compatibles avec HTTP/2 et mettez-les à jour si nécessaire. Les navigateurs modernes ont déjà embarqué ce protocole ; il est donc temps que vos infrastructures suivent le mouvement.

Déploiement progressif et tests

Procédez par étapes lors du déploiement d’HTTP/2 : commencez par une phase de test pour identifier tout problème potentiel. Utilisez des outils comme WebPageTest pour observer les améliorations en termes de performance. En incorporant ces pratiques, on observe souvent une expérience utilisateur enrichie grâce à la réduction significative des temps de chargement, un atout concurrentiel sûr dans notre monde numérique rapide !

Questions fréquemment posées

Quels sont les principaux avantages de HTTP/2 pour la performance d’un site web?

HTTP/2 introduit plusieurs améliorations significatives par rapport à HTTP/1.1, notamment le multiplexage, permettant l’envoi simultané de plusieurs requêtes sur une seule connexion TCP. Cela réduit la latence et améliore le chargement des ressources. Il utilise également la compression des en-têtes pour réduire la taille des données échangées et offre un mécanisme de priorisation des ressources, ce qui optimise l’ordre de chargement des éléments de la page.

Comment le multiplexage dans HTTP/2 contribue-t-il à augmenter la vitesse d’un site web?

Le multiplexage est une fonctionnalité clé de HTTP/2 qui permet à plusieurs requêtes et réponses de coexister sur la même connexion. Cela élimine le problème du « head-of-line blocking » propre à HTTP/1.1 où les requêtes doivent attendre que celles devant elles soient traitées. Ainsi, les ressources sont téléchargées en parallèle plutôt que séquentiellement, ce qui diminue le temps total nécessaire pour charger une page web.

En quoi la compression des en-têtes dans HTTP/2 améliore-t-elle les performances d’un site?

Dans HTTP/2, la compression des en-têtes HPACK réduit considérablement la quantité de données transmises pendant les échanges entre le client et le serveur. Puisque les en-têtes contiennent souvent des informations redondantes, cette méthode de compression évite leur envoi répété et diminue ainsi le volume global de données envoyées lors d’une session. Cette efficacité se traduit par un temps de chargement plus rapide pour l’utilisateur final.

5/5 - (3 votes)